US 12,106,720 B2
Display device and method of operating the display device
Hyojin Lee, Gyeonggi-do (KR); Woomi Bae, Daegu (KR); Hui Nam, Gyeonggi-do (KR); Jinyoung Roh, Gyeonggi-do (KR); Sehyuk Park, Gyeonggi-do (KR); and Jaekeun Lim, Gyeonggi-do (KR)
Assigned to SAMSUNG DISPLAY CO., LTD., Gyeonggi-Do (KR)
Filed by SAMSUNG DISPLAY CO., LTD., Gyeonggi-do (KR)
Filed on Jul. 13, 2022, as Appl. No. 17/863,519.
Claims priority of application No. 10-2021-0116888 (KR), filed on Sep. 2, 2021.
Prior Publication US 2023/0065185 A1, Mar. 2, 2023
Int. Cl. G09G 3/3266 (2016.01)
CPC G09G 3/3266 (2013.01) [G09G 2320/0247 (2013.01); G09G 2320/0271 (2013.01); G09G 2360/14 (2013.01)] 20 Claims

1. A display device comprising:
a display panel including a plurality of pixel rows;
a panel driver which drives the display panel; and
a scan driver including a plurality of stages respectively providing scan signals to the plurality of pixel rows,
wherein the panel driver determines whether input image data represents a still image,
wherein, when the input image data represents the still image, the panel driver determines a flicker value of the still image, applies a compensation value corresponding to a carry shift interval to the flicker value, determines a driving frequency for the display panel based on the flicker value to which the compensation value is applied, and performs an alternate driving operation for the display panel at the driving frequency,
wherein the scan driver shifts a carry signal at the carry shift interval in the plurality of stages,
wherein the carry shift interval is an interval between a first stage which applies the carry signal and a second stage which directly receives the carry signal among the plurality of stages, and
wherein the carry shift interval is controlled by a first switch and a second switch respectively connected to an input terminal of the first stage and an input terminal of the second stage.
